For more * information on the Apache Software Foundation, please see * . */ package org.apache.poi.hwpf.model.hdftypes; import org.apache.poi.util.BitField; import org.apache.poi.util.LittleEndian; /** * FFN - Font Family Name. FFN is a data structure that stores the names of the Main * Font and that of Alternate font as an array of characters. It has also a header * that stores info about the whole structure and the fonts * * @author Praveen Mathew */ public class Ffn { private int field1_cbFfnM1;//total length of FFN - 1. private byte field2; private static BitField _prq = new BitField(0x0003);// pitch request private static BitField _fTrueType = new BitField(0x0004);// when 1, font is a TrueType font private static BitField _ff = new BitField(0x0070); private short field3_wWeight;// base weight of font private byte field4_chs;// character set identifier private byte field5_ixchSzAlt; // index into ffn.szFfn to the name of // the alternate font private byte [] panose = new byte[10];//???? private byte [] fontSig = new byte[24];//???? // zero terminated string that records name of font, cuurently not // supporting Extended chars private char [] xszFfn; private int xszFfnLength; public Ffn(byte[] buf, int offset) { field1_cbFfnM1 = LittleEndian.getUnsignedByte(buf,offset); offset += LittleEndian.BYTE_SIZE; field2 = buf[offset]; offset += LittleEndian.BYTE_SIZE; field3_wWeight = LittleEndian.getShort(buf, offset); offset += LittleEndian.SHORT_SIZE; field4_chs = buf[offset]; offset += LittleEndian.BYTE_SIZE; field5_ixchSzAlt = buf[offset]; offset += LittleEndian.BYTE_SIZE; // read panose and fs so we can write them back out. System.arraycopy(buf, offset, panose, 0, panose.length); offset += panose.length; System.arraycopy(buf, offset, fontSig, 0, fontSig.length); offset += fontSig.length; xszFfnLength = this.getSize() - offset; xszFfn = new char[xszFfnLength]; for(int i = 0; i < xszFfnLength; i++) { xszFfn[i] = (char)LittleEndian.getUnsignedByte(buf, offset); offset += LittleEndian.BYTE_SIZE; } } public int getField1_cbFfnM1() { return field1_cbFfnM1; } public int getSize() { return (field1_cbFfnM1 + 1); } public char [] getMainFontName() { char [] temp = new char[field5_ixchSzAlt]; System.arraycopy(xszFfn,0,temp,0,temp.length); return temp; } public char [] getAltFontName() { char [] temp = new char[xszFfnLength - field5_ixchSzAlt]; System.arraycopy(xszFfn, field5_ixchSzAlt, temp, 0, temp.length); return temp; } public void setField1_cbFfnM1(int field1_cbFfnM1) { this.field1_cbFfnM1 = field1_cbFfnM1; } // changed protected to public public byte[] toByteArray() { int offset = 0; byte[] buf = new byte[this.getSize()]; buf[offset] = (byte)field1_cbFfnM1; offset += LittleEndian.BYTE_SIZE; buf[offset] = field2; offset += LittleEndian.BYTE_SIZE; LittleEndian.putShort(buf, offset, field3_wWeight); offset += LittleEndian.SHORT_SIZE; buf[offset] = field4_chs; offset += LittleEndian.BYTE_SIZE; buf[offset] = field5_ixchSzAlt; offset += LittleEndian.BYTE_SIZE; System.arraycopy(panose,0,buf, offset,panose.length); offset += panose.length; System.arraycopy(fontSig,0,buf, offset, fontSig.length); offset += fontSig.length; for(int i = 0; i < xszFfn.length; i++) { buf[offset] = (byte)xszFfn[i]; offset += LittleEndian.BYTE_SIZE; } return buf; } }
